When choosing a font for your website, it’s important to consider a few factors:

 

  1. Legibility: The font you choose should be easy to read and not strain the reader’s eyes. Avoid using fancy or decorative fonts for body text, as they can be difficult to read at small sizes.
  2. Branding: The font you choose should match your brand’s style and personality. If your brand is modern and minimalistic, for example, a sleek sans-serif font might be a good choice.
  3. Web-friendliness: Not all fonts are web-friendly, which means they may not display correctly on all devices and browsers. To ensure that your font displays correctly, it’s best to use a web-safe font or a font that is widely supported by web browsers.
  4. Performance: Some fonts can slow down your website’s loading time, so it’s important to choose a font that is lightweight and optimized for the web.
  5. Test your font: Before settling on a font, test it out on different devices and screen sizes to make sure it looks good and is easy to read.
  6. Use web-safe fonts: Web-safe fonts are those that are widely available on different devices and platforms, ensuring that your website looks consistent across all devices. Examples of web-safe fonts include Arial, Times New Roman, and Verdana.
  7. Keep it simple: Stick to simple, clean fonts that are easy to read. Avoid using too many different fonts, as this can make your website look cluttered.
  8. Consider the overall design: Your font should complement the overall design of your website. Consider the style and mood you want to convey and choose a font that reflects that.

 

Some popular fonts that are widely supported by web browsers and are suitable for use on websites include Arial, Verdana, and Georgia. Ultimately, the best font for your website will depend on your specific needs and design goals.
